Sunday, April 19, 2015

Script Analisis Kecepatan Situs dengan SiteSpeed.io

SiteSpeed.io adalah script analisis kecepatan situs dan performanya secara umum. Tool ini membantu kita menganalisis kecepatan akses situs, best practices performa yang tercatat dan matrik waktu yang dibutuhkan.

Cara kerja mempercepat situs dengan SiteSpeed.io sebenarnya tergantung dari tindak lanjut atas report yang dihasilkan dengan SiteSpeed.io itu sendiri. SiteSpeed.io akan menggali data dari sejumlah halaman pada web kita, menganalisisnya dengan rule-rule tertentu dan menghasilkan output berupa file HTML yang bisa kita baca.

Dengan SiteSpeed.io sebenarnya kita bisa menganalisis lebih dari situs, menganalisis dan membandingkan satu situs dengan situs lain.

Logo SiteSpeed.io

Cara Install SiteSpeed.io

SiteSpeed.io pada dasarnya adalah skrip NodeJS, sehingga untuk menginstallnya, cukup dengan menggunakan fasilitas dari npm.

[sourcecode]
npm install -g sitespeed.io
[/sourcecode]

Sedangkan Cara untuk menjalankan SiteSpeed.io adalah lewat command line dengan perintah:
[sourcecode]
sitespeed.io -h
[/sourcecode]

Adapun kelebihan dari SiteSpeed.io antara lain:
1. Hasil report yang bisa dibaca bahkan oleh orang yang cukup awam dengan monitoring server. Hasil yang berupa file HTML tersebut disajikan dalam kolom-kolom yang diberi warna-warna yang cukup mencolok dan membedakan satu sama lainnya.




  1. SiteSpeed.io sangat mendukung dijalankan sebagai aksi berkala (cron). Kita bisa melakukannya dengan plugin GruntJS. (kapan-kapan kita akan bahas ini)


  2. Mendukung waktu fetch dengan browser asli yang terpasang di mesin. Untuk sementara, SiteSpeed.io hanya mendukung browser Chrome dan Firefox.


  3. Dikembangkan secara opensource, sehingga lebih terpercaya dan dapat dikembangkan lebih lanjut tanpa harus takut terkekang.


0 comments:

Post a Comment